			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Here&#8217;s an interesting article on the debate over how to classify something as a sport. Quinnipiac University decided to save money by ending the girl&#8217;s volleyball program and replacing it with competitive cheerleading. Quinnipiac has also allegedly manipulated the size of their rosters for other sports to get around complying with Title IX. This is an unfortunate situation, yet at the same time has the potential to help competitive cheer become a recognized sport by the NCAA.</p>
<p>In my opinion, it meets all the qualifications necessary. Under Title IX, &#8220;It must have coaches, practices, competitions during a defined season,  and a governing organization. The activity also must have competition as  its primary goal – not merely the support of other athletic teams.&#8221; It looks like the judge agrees with this and it will be interesting to see what the outcome is, both for Quinnipiac and for competitive cheer as a sport.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>In our penultimate class, we looked at independent sports film production and the rise of extreme sports. More info on Warren Miller, guru of the ski film, can be found in <a href="http://www.nytimes.com/2009/11/21/movies/21miller.html?_r=1">this</a> <em>New York Times</em> profile.</p>
<p>What might be the first skateboard movie, <em>Skater Dater</em> (1967), can be seen below. It won best short subject at Cannes, and is a silent 16mm romance:</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Robin Hanson has an interesting <a href="http://www.overcomingbias.com/2010/06/athletes-vs-musicians.html">post</a> up on how athletes are held to a different set of moral standards than other celebrities:</p>
<blockquote>
<p style="text-align:left;">Consider three kinds of celebrities: politicians, athletes, and  musicians.  We clearly hold politicians to higher moral and social  standards than we do musicians.  This makes sense because we feel more  vulnerable to bad behavior by politicians than by musicians.  An out of  control politician could kill us all, while an out of control musician  would at worst just fail to make music we like.</p>
<p style="text-align:left;">What about athletes?  While we may not hold athletes to the high of  standards we hold politicians, we clearly hold them to higher standards  than musicians.  Tiger Woods was vilified for moral violations that  wouldn’t be worth reporting about a musician.  Yet the above explanation  for politicians vs. musicians doesn’t work here.  While we are no more  vulnerable to athletes than to musicians, we still hold athletes to a  higher standard.</p>
